The honest truth is, all though the other kill switch methods are impressive, they are basically worthless. The current system on our trucks needs the right key with the correct chip or it will not start. Is it the lastest and greatest system out there? Yes and no, those that may be out for a night wanting to steal their first car/truck won't be able to but professional auto theifs will. Professional will get past ALL by-pass and kill systems.

Bottom line if someone wants a truck/car or what ever bad enough it WILL be taken and there is NOTHING you can do about it. As for all those nice and time consuming kill switches, well they don't do so well when someone just hooks up to your truck and drags it off, just like the repo man, you will not stop him/her from taken your truck.

Sure they may not be able to drive it but alot of times they steal them and part them out.

My advice is have the insurance you need to replace it if stolen and don't worry about it. If it happens it happens and you can just go get a nice new truck...
